Fruit and Herb Infused Water

Ideas and Recipes
Spring: Strawberry + Lemon
- Strawberry, 3 large
- Lemon, 3 thin slices
Summer: Peach + Blueberry
- Peach, 1/2
- Blueberry, handful
Fall: Apple + Pear
- Apple, 1/3
- Pear, 1/3
Winter: Rosemary + Ginger + Lemon
- Rosemary, 1 sprig
- Ginger, 5 slices
- Lemon, 2 slices
Refreshing: Cucumber + Mint
- Mini cucumber, 1
- Mint, 5 leaves
Citrus: Orange + Grape
- Orange, 1/2
- Grape, handful
Tropical: Mango + Pineapple
- Mango, 1/3
- Pineapple,
Or watermelon, lime, grapefruit…literally any combination you fancy
Directions:
Wash and slice fruits and herbs thinly. Get organic fruits if you could.
Add fruits and herbs in 1L of water, or 0.5L if you plan on adding sparkling water later.
Infuse in the fridge for 1 hour.
Serve as is, or add sparkling water before serving.
What is so good about these fruit infused water?
First of all, they are hydrating. Shout out to all of you who have trouble getting enough water. You have probably heard that water is the best way to hydrate, but plain water could get a little boring. Adding fruits to water makes it taste so much better, and makes drinking water so much more fun. For those with little ones at home, now aren’t they going to ask for more water all the time?
Secondly, fruit infused water looks pretty. Nobody can doubt the importance of presentation. Colourful fruits floating in sparkling water in a classic maison jar, shining under the sun on your balcony…how pretty is that! Your guests will be so impressed and will want to make it at home. You could even level up the game and have an infused water menu for that big family dinner or summer party.
On top of that, they are nutritious. You have probably thought about this one already, because they are a lot less in sugar than juice and pop. Ditch those vitamin waters full of additives, who will need them when you can use real fruits to make natural vitamin water? Some people drinks flavoured beverages just because they don’t like blend plain water, but now you have a perfect alternative.
